The street in brief

Huxley Row is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£1,049,950 — roughly 78% above the CB3 norm. On floor area that works out near £5,494 per square metre, in line with the district's £5,688. Recent sales here have lagged the wider CB3 market. HM Land Registry records 9 sales across 9 homes since 2023 — the street turns over frequently.

Huxley Row's £1,049,950 median sits about 78% above CB3's £590,995; on floor space it runs £5,494/m² against the district's £5,688/m².

Street and CB3 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
